The C-wire is a pivotal wire that can significantly impact your thermostat installation and overall HVAC system functionality.What is a Thermostat C Wire? The C wire is an extra wire that is used to create a continuous 24V power loop between your thermostat and the rest of the HVAC system. It allows the power to be used for any application and allows more advanced thermostats to function to their highest potential. Although the common wire may be labeled differently in different switches, it typically will have a black, white, or red color.The C wire (common wire) powers a smart thermostat by providing a constant flow of 24 VAC (volts AC). The term "constant flow" is the key here, because the C wire isn't the source of power. The R wires are the actual source of power, but they are not continuous, hence the use of the C wire. They are all wired to the same bus bar in the main b...American wire gauge size calculator and chart. Wire gauge calculations Wire diameter calculations. The n gauge wire diameter d n in inches (in) is equal to 0.005in times 92 raised to the power of 36 minus gauge number n, divided by 39:. d n (in) = 0.005 in × 92 (36-n)/39. This ...Wire gauge is the most common measurement of the size, either diameter or cross-sectional area, of a wire. A wire’s gauge determines not only the maximum rated current for the wire, but also the resistive losses as current travels through it.
